Fuqua gives his Consent

Antoine Fuqua, better known for his directorial work in features such as Training Day and Brooklyn’s Finest, is signing up to direct Consent to Kill. The feature is based off of a novel of the same name, written up by Vince Flynn. In Flynn’s story, Rapp battled a vengeful Saudi billionaire, an ex – East German Stasi spy and a husband-and-wife team of assassins — all while dealing with a knee injury (Variety).

Producing is Lorenzo di Bonaventura along with Nick Wechsler with Jonathan Lemkin penning the script. Lemkin’s previous written works include Lethal Weapon 4 and Red Planet. Fuqua is keeping himself busy, currently in the midst of pre-production of the upcoming biopic entitled Pablo Escobar.
